The daytime levels, and only the daytime levels, were actually decent in Unleashed.

He can do it...just hand the reigns to Dimps and keep Sonic Team far away.

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dimps

They made the great Sonic Rush games on DS, which were 2D.
And Sonic Advance. And DBZ: Budokai 1 and 2. They also co-developed Street Fighter 4.

And did the DAYTIME stages for Unleashed. For the Wii version, but that actually is generally regarded as superior to the 360/PS3 versions.
